> BTW, the patch uses functions from text-property-search.el.
> But these useful functions are still not autoloaded.
> Here is the patch to autoload them:

I don't necessarily disagree, but do we have any policies or
guidelines regarding when to autoload a function?  It saves us a
'require', but what we "gain" instead is a (small) inflation of the
base memory footprint of the Emacs process.  So it isn't free.
